Kingdra vs Kingdra δ


Kingdra (Aquapolis) and Kingdra δ (Holon Phantoms) are frequently compared because they share the same Pokémon identity across different printings. This page breaks down which one is the better buy right now.
Current TCGPlayer market prices put the two at $599.99 for Kingdra and $161.97 for Kingdra δ — a gap of $438.02 (270%). Prices update daily, and the two charts below show how each has moved.
Stat comparison
| Market price | $599.99 | $161.97 |
| Set | Aquapolis | Holon Phantoms |
| Number | #148 | #10 |
| HP | 110 | 110 |
| Type | Colorless | Fire, Metal |
| Subtypes | Stage 2 | Stage 2 |
| Retreat cost | 3 | 2 |
| Rarity | Rare Secret | Rare Holo |

Which should you buy?
When comparing Kingdra (Aquapolis #148) against Kingdra δ (Holon Phantoms #10), the most immediate difference is price. Kingdra currently trades at roughly $599.99 while Kingdra δ sits near $161.97 — a gap of about $438.02 (270%). That spread alone is often the deciding factor for buyers weighing the two. Both cards sit at 110 HP, so raw survivability on the active spot is roughly equivalent. Kingdra is a Colorless-type while Kingdra δ is Fire-type, so the two can coexist in an energy-diverse build without fighting for the same attachments. Both are printings of the same character. One comes from Aquapolis (2003/01/15) and the other from Holon Phantoms (2006/05/01). Competitive players usually pick whichever printing is currently legal in the format they play, while collectors often want both for visual variety. Rarity is another dividing line: Kingdra is Rare Secret while Kingdra δ is Rare Holo, which typically explains most of the price gap and signals different print volumes.
